AI音乐生成与作曲软体市场预计将以20.1%的年复合成长率成长,到2036年达到72.9亿美元。本报告对五大主要地区的AI音乐产生市场进行了详细分析,重点关注当前市场趋势、市场规模、近期发展以及至2036年的预测。透过广泛的二级和一级研究以及对市场现状的深入分析,对关键产业驱动因素、限制因素、机会和挑战进行了影响分析。市场成长的驱动力来自内容创作平台的爆炸式成长,这些平台对经济实惠的音乐解决方案的需求日益成长;内容创作者和媒体製作人对免版税音乐的需求不断增加;人工智能(AI)和机器学习技术的进步使得逼真的音乐生成成为可能;降低音乐许可成本和版权问题的需求不断成长;以及人工智能生成的音乐平台在广告、人工智能平台上的音乐应用和版权。此外,用于音乐生成的先进生成对抗网路(GAN)和 Transformer 模型的发展、AI音乐工具与内容创作工作流程的整合、AI生成音乐新型授权模式的出现,以及AI生成音乐在专业创意产业中日益普及,预计都将进一步推动市场成长。

According to the research report titled, 'AI Music Generation & Composition Software Market by Music Genre, Customization Options, Licensing Model (Royalty-Free, Exclusive), and End-User (Content Creators, Game Developers) - Global Forecasts (2026-2036),' the AI music generation and composition software market is projected to reach USD 7.29 billion by 2036, at a CAGR of 20.1% during the forecast period 2026-2036. The report provides an in-depth analysis of the global AI music generation market across five major regions, emphasizing the current market trends, market sizes, recent developments, and forecasts till 2036. Following extensive secondary and primary research and an in-depth analysis of the market scenario, the report conducts the impact analysis of the key industry drivers, restraints, opportunities, and challenges. The growth of this market is driven by the explosive growth of content creation platforms requiring affordable music solutions, rising demand for royalty-free music from content creators and media producers, advancements in artificial intelligence and machine learning enabling realistic music generation, the need to reduce music licensing costs and copyright issues, and increasing adoption of AI-generated music in advertising, gaming, and streaming platforms. Moreover, the development of advanced generative adversarial networks (GANs) and transformer models for music generation, the integration of AI music tools with content creation workflows, the emergence of new licensing models for AI-generated music, and the growing acceptance of AI-generated music in professional creative industries are expected to support the market's growth.

Market Segmentation

The AI music generation and composition software market is segmented by music genre (electronic, hip-hop, pop, rock, classical, ambient, and others), customization options (full customization, template-based, and preset-based), licensing model (royalty-free, exclusive, and subscription-based), end-user (content creators, game developers, film and television producers, advertisers, and music producers), deployment model (cloud-based, on-premises, and hybrid), and geography. The study also evaluates industry competitors and analyzes the market at the country level.

Based on Music Genre

Based on music genre, the electronic music segment is estimated to hold the largest share of the market in 2026. This segment's dominance is primarily attributed to the ease of generating electronic music with AI algorithms, the popularity of electronic music in gaming and content creation, and the lower complexity compared to other genres. Conversely, the ambient and background music segment is expected to grow at a significant CAGR during the forecast period, driven by increasing demand for ambient music in meditation apps, streaming platforms, and video content.

Based on Customization Options

Based on customization options, the template-based segment is estimated to account for the largest share of the market in 2026. This segment's leadership is primarily driven by ease of use for non-professional users, faster music generation, and lower technical barriers to entry. The full customization segment is expected to grow at the highest CAGR during the forecast period, driven by increasing demand from professional musicians and producers seeking greater creative control and unique compositions.

Based on Licensing Model

Based on licensing model, the royalty-free segment is estimated to hold the largest share of the market in 2026. This segment's dominance is driven by the popularity of royalty-free music among content creators, the cost-effectiveness compared to traditional music licensing, and the elimination of copyright issues. The exclusive licensing segment is expected to experience significant growth, driven by content creators and media producers seeking unique, exclusive music for premium content.

Based on End-User

Based on end-user, the content creators segment is estimated to account for the largest share of the market in 2026. This segment's dominance is driven by the massive growth of content creation platforms like YouTube, TikTok, and Twitch, and the need for affordable, copyright-free music. The game developers segment is expected to grow at a significant CAGR during the forecast period, driven by increasing demand for dynamic, adaptive music in video games and the cost savings compared to traditional music composition.

Geographic Analysis

An in-depth geographic analysis of the industry provides detailed qualitative and quantitative insights into the five major regions (North America, Europe, Asia-Pacific, Latin America, and the Middle East & Africa) and the coverage of major countries in each region. In 2026, North America is estimated to account for the largest share of the global AI music generation market, driven by a concentrated content creator ecosystem, leading AI technology companies, entertainment industry adoption, and strong venture capital investment in music AI startups. Asia-Pacific is projected to register the highest CAGR during the forecast period, fueled by massive social media and short-form video growth, gaming industry expansion, increasing content creator population, and AI technology development in China and Japan. The region's rapid digital transformation and growing creator economy are creating substantial market opportunities.
